‘A Quiet Place’ movie with 86% RT score is now streaming, improving the $899 million franchise

A quiet place: day onea new film in the A quiet place Franchise is now streaming after improving on the hugely successful series. John Krasinski helped launch the original horror/sci-fi title in 2018 as director and lead actor, and the film’s success allowed him and Paramount to work together to expand the world with additional entries. Each A quiet place The film is set in a world where sound-sensitive aliens have invaded Earth, devastating humanity and forcing them to live in a constant state of near-silence.




While the two original films focused on the roles of John Krasinski and Emily Blunt as the parents of the Abbott family, A quiet place: day one offered the opportunity to explore a different side of the franchise. The dangers faced by the characters in each entry are the same, as the aliens known as the Angels of Death wreak havoc every time a sudden noise is heard nearby. An entire planet succumbs to the alien invasion. A quiet place: day one‘s streaming debut is another opportunity to explore the impact of their arrival at different points in the growing A quiet place Timeline.

‘A Quiet Place: Day One’ is now streaming on Paramount Plus – why you should watch it

A quiet place: day one is now streaming on Paramount+, marking the first time the film has been available on a streaming service. This comes after a successful theatrical release, where it played exclusively in theaters for over 50 days. The film follows Sam (Lupita Nyong’o) and Eric (Joseph Quinn), as well as the cat Frodo, as they try to survive the first few days in New York after the alien invasion.


It is a joy to see A quiet place: day onebe it for a re-watch or if you have waited until the release on Paramount+. The film has everything fans of the franchise expect in terms of action, thrills and characters. Sam and Eric are instantly cheering, and Nyong’o and Quinn effortlessly make you care about their characters to survive the whole ordeal. Since the entire film is told from one of the two perspectives, their harmony on screen and the warmth they bring to their performances is what makes the film so captivating.


The supporting A quiet place: day one The cast is rather small, although It is always a pleasure to see Djimon Hounsouespecially in this case, as it provides some additional details about his character A quiet place part II. What the film lacks in co-stars for Nyong’o and Quinn, it makes up for with great character development and plenty of action sequences that increase the entertainment value. It’s a much louder film than previous installments, as the film is set in New York at the beginning, but the necessary silence accompanies the story as it progresses.

This may not be a perfect film, but it all comes together with a strong third act that A quiet place: day oneThe ending is a highlight. With a runtime of 1 hour and 39 minutes, the pace is fast and it’s always moving forward. It’s a pretty fast-paced, entertaining and often thrilling experience for anyone who is a fan of the sci-fi/horror genre or wants to make sure they stay up to date with the latest developments in the franchise. It’s an installment that certainly helps to improve the franchise overall with such a carefully constructed and impactful story.

How “A Quiet Place: Day One” compares to the other films in the franchise

Lupita Nyong'o and Joseph Quinn in A Quiet Place: Day One


A quiet place: day oneThe release of The 4000 on streaming comes after a successful theatrical release that nearly saw the franchise achieve massive box office success. The film had the best opening weekend of the franchise, having grossed $52 million in the first few days of release. This drove A quiet place: day oneThe box office receipts amounted to $138.9 million domestically. With another $122.2 million overseas, the worldwide total was $261.1 million, with The franchise has now grossed a total of $899 million worldwide.

All three brands are franchise lows, but A quiet place: day one was still a success before it hit streaming. With a reported budget of just $67 million, the film grossed more than four times its cost at the box office, which is usually more than enough for a film to turn a profit. The strong performance came after positive reviews, which earned the film a Tomatometer rating of 86% on Rotten Tomatoes, while the Popcornmeter is also in positive territory with a rating of 73%.


Part of what A quiet place: day one stand out from the two previous parts in the franchise is how different it is. The differences range from the time setting, which makes it a prequel, to the focus on characters other than the Abbotts, to the shifting of the main setting to New York City, to a more personal story at the center. There are certainly still moments of action and thrills, but the relationship between Eric and Sam makes A quiet place: day one more dramatic than anything the audience has ever seen before.

All these differences, no matter how big or small, contribute to A quiet place: day one a film that is well worth checking out now that it is available on streaming. The core familiar elements and setup of the franchise remain intact, but the film does not simply copy the story of a previous film and paste it into a new set of characters and settings. There is something fresh here that A quiet place: day one away from the rest of the franchise and shows what future films could explore in this world.
